reinstatement of certificate. If a chiropractic radiographer fails to maintain an active certification as provided in chapter 20:41:13, the certification lapses on the date immediately following the final date of the period for which it was last renewed. No person may practice as a chiropractic radiographer in South Dakota with a lapsed certificate. If a certificate has been in lapse status for less than two years, applicant may convert to an active South Dakota certification by paying the license fee, submitting a renewal application, and providing continuing education as required by § 20:41:13:12. If a certificate has been in lapse status two years or more, the applicant must retake and pass a board approved chiropractic radiographer examination and reapply for certification.
Source: 41 SDR 109, effective January 12, 2015; 47 SDR 41, effective October 12, 2020.
